Article: AN/MSN-7 MOBILE AIR TRAFFIC CONTROL TOWER KEEPS SKIES SAFER IN THEATER

Robins Air Force Base issued the following news release:

Ensuring a safe flying environment can be challenging for air traffic controllers, especially at a Basic Expeditionary Airfield Resources Base.

The Air Force is coupling some of its state-of-the-art technology with the expertise of its combat communications professionals to meet this challenge.

Most fixed air traffic control towers stand stories tall, but with the advancement of modern technology, Airmen can deliver the same capability from the back of a Humvee.
